📖 Definitions of "Laird"
noun
- 1
The owner of a Scottish estate; a member of the landed gentry, a landowner.
- 2
Often in the form Laird of, followed by a patronymic: a Scottish clan chief.
verb
- 1
Chiefly as laird it over: to behave like a laird, particularly to act haughtily or to domineer; to lord (it over).
